What companies run services between Birmingham, England and Cheltenham (Station), England?

National Express operates a bus from Birmingham Coach Station to Arle Court Transport Hub every 3 hours. Tickets cost £9–23 and the journey takes 1h 15m. FlixBus also services this route 3 times a day. Alternatively, Cross Country operates a train from Birmingham New Street to Cheltenham Spa every 30 minutes. Tickets cost £24–35 and the journey takes 45 min.
